Describe with one example, how moderately reactive metals (which are in the middle of the reactivity series) are extracted.

Solution:

The oxides of moderately reactive metals are reduced with carbon, aluminum sodium, or calcium to extract them.

Example:

When zinc sulphate is heated to high temperatures in the air, zinc oxide and sulphur dioxide are formed. This is referred to as roasting. Zinc metal is formed when zinc oxide is heated with carbon. This is referred to as reduction.
